U kunt de numerieke millisecondenversie van timestamp
. toevoegen als een virtueel attribuut op het schema:
schema.virtual('timestamp_ms').get(function() {
return this.timestamp.getTime();
});
Vervolgens kunt u de opname van het virtuele veld inschakelen in toObject
roept modelinstanties aan via een optie in uw schema:
var schema = new Schema({
timestamp: Date
}, {
toObject: { getters: true }
});